-
3
-
-
0032294765
-
Conditioned program slicing
-
G. Canfora, A. Cimitile, and A. D. Lucia. Conditioned program slicing. Information and Software Technology (special issue on program slicing), 40(11/12):595-607, 1998.
-
(1998)
Information and Software Technology (Special Issue on Program Slicing)
, vol.40
, Issue.11-12
, pp. 595-607
-
-
Canfora, A.1
Cimitile, G.2
Lucia, A.D.3
-
6
-
-
0025245266
-
Reverse engineering and design recovery: A taxonomy
-
E. Chikofsky and J. H. C. II. Reverse engineering and design recovery: a taxonomy. IEEE Software, 7(1):13-17, 1990.
-
(1990)
IEEE Software
, vol.7
, Issue.1
, pp. 13-17
-
-
Chikofsky, E.1
Ii, J.H.C.2
-
7
-
-
0030143835
-
A specification driven slicing process for identifying reusable functions
-
A. Cimitile, A. D. Lucia, and M. C. Munro. A specification driven slicing process for identifying reusable functions. Journal of Software Maintenance: Research and Practice, 8(3):145-178, 1996.
-
(1996)
Journal of Software Maintenance: Research and Practice
, vol.8
, Issue.3
, pp. 145-178
-
-
Cimitile, A.D.1
Lucia, A.2
Munro, M.C.3
-
8
-
-
0034512762
-
Consit: A conditioned program slicer
-
San Jose, California, USA, October 11-14, IEEE CS Press
-
S. Danicic, C. Fox, M. Harman, and R. Hierons. Consit: A conditioned program slicer. In 16th IEEE International Conference on Software Maintenance, San Jose, California, USA, October 11-14 2000. IEEE CS Press.
-
(2000)
16th IEEE International Conference on Software Maintenance
-
-
Danicic, C.1
Fox, M.2
Harman, S.3
Hierons, R.4
-
9
-
-
84952910555
-
Consus: A scalable approach to conditioned slicing
-
Richmond, Virginia, USA, 28 October-1 November, IEEE CS Press
-
D. Daoudi, S. Danicic, J. Howroyd, M. Harman, C. Fox, and M. Ward. Consus: A scalable approach to conditioned slicing. In 9th IEEE Working Conference on Reverse Engineering, Richmond, Virginia, USA, 28 October-1 November 2002. IEEE CS Press.
-
(2002)
9th IEEE Working Conference on Reverse Engineering
-
-
Daoudi, S.1
Danicic, J.2
Howroyd, M.3
Harman, C.4
Fox, D.5
Ward, M.6
-
10
-
-
84884726547
-
Functional programming with bananas, lenses, envelopes and barbed wire
-
March
-
M. F. Erik Meijer and R. Paterson. Functional programming with bananas, lenses, envelopes and barbed wire. In Proceedings FPCA'91, March 1991.
-
(1991)
Proceedings FPCA'91
-
-
Erik Meijer, M.F.1
Paterson, R.2
-
13
-
-
0029209969
-
Strongest postcondition semantics as the formal basis for reverse engineering
-
July
-
G. Gannod and B. Cheng. Strongest postcondition semantics as the formal basis for reverse engineering. In 1995 Work. Conference on Reverse Engineering, pages 188-197, July 1995.
-
(1995)
1995 Work. Conference on Reverse Engineering
, pp. 188-197
-
-
Gannod, G.1
Cheng, B.2
-
14
-
-
0030399283
-
Using informal and formal techniques for the reverse engineering of C programs
-
Michigan State University
-
G. Gannod and B. Cheng. Using informal and formal techniques for the reverse engineering of C programs. Technical report, DCS, Michigan State University, 1996.
-
(1996)
Technical Report, DCS
-
-
Gannod, G.1
Cheng, B.2
-
15
-
-
0002973091
-
A formal apprach for reverse engineering: A case study
-
G. Gannod and B. Cheng. A formal apprach for reverse engineering: a case study. In WCRE'99, 1999.
-
(1999)
WCRE'99
-
-
Gannod, G.1
Cheng, B.2
-
19
-
-
0030697758
-
Amorphous program slicing
-
Dearborn, Michigan, USA, May 1997), IEEE CS Press, Los Alamitos, California, USA
-
M. Harman and S. Danicic. Amorphous program slicing. In Proceedings of the 5th IEEE Internation Workshop on Program Comprehesion (IWPC'97) (Dearborn, Michigan, USA, May 1997), pages 70-79. IEEE CS Press, Los Alamitos, California, USA, 1997.
-
(1997)
Proceedings of the 5th IEEE Internation Workshop on Program Comprehesion (IWPC'97)
, pp. 70-79
-
-
Harman, M.1
Danicic, S.2
-
20
-
-
77956782567
-
Program simplifications as a means of approximating undecidable propositions
-
Pittsburgh, Pennsylvania, USA, May
-
M. Harman, C. Fox, R. Hierons, D. Binkley, and S. Danicic. Program simplifications as a means of approximating undecidable propositions. In 7th IEEE International Workshop on Program Comprehension, Pittsburgh, Pennsylvania, USA, May 1999.
-
(1999)
7th IEEE International Workshop on Program Comprehension
-
-
Harman, C.1
Fox, R.2
Hierons, D.3
Binkley, M.4
Danicic, S.5
-
21
-
-
77956617375
-
Pre/post conditioned slicing
-
Florence, Italy, November 6-10
-
M. Harman, R. Hierons, C. Fox, S. Danicic, and J. Howroyd. Pre/post conditioned slicing. In 17th IEEE International Conference on Software Maintenance, Florence, Italy, November 6-10 2001.
-
(2001)
17th IEEE International Conference on Software Maintenance
-
-
Harman, R.1
Hierons, C.2
Fox, S.3
Danicic, M.4
Howroyd, J.5
-
22
-
-
0006329746
-
Program analysis and test hypotheses complement
-
Limerick, Ireland, June 4-5
-
R. Hierons and M. Harman. Program analysis and test hypotheses complement. In 22nd IEEE/ACM ICSE, 1st International Workshop on Automated Program Analysis, Testing and Verification, Limerick, Ireland, June 4-5 2000.
-
(2000)
22nd IEEE/ACM ICSE, 1st International Workshop on Automated Program Analysis, Testing and Verification
-
-
Hierons, R.1
Harman, M.2
-
23
-
-
0036495168
-
Conditioned slicing support partition testing
-
R. Hierons, M. Harman, C. Fox, L. Ouarbya, and D. Daoudi. Conditioned slicing support partition testing. Journal of Software Testing, Verification and Reliability, 12(1):23-28, 2002.
-
(2002)
Journal of Software Testing, Verification and Reliability
, vol.12
, Issue.1
, pp. 23-28
-
-
Hierons, M.1
Harman, C.2
Fox, L.3
Ouarbya, R.4
Daoudi, D.5
-
24
-
-
84884725160
-
Catamorphism-based transformation of functional program
-
University of Tokyo, June
-
Z. Hu, H. Iwasaki, and M. Takeichi. Catamorphism-based transformation of functional program. Technical report, University of Tokyo, June 1994.
-
(1994)
Technical Report
-
-
Hu, H.1
Iwasaki, Z.2
Takeichi, M.3
-
26
-
-
0003648103
-
-
Prentice-Hall International, second edition, October
-
C. Morgan. Programming from specification. Prentice-Hall International, second edition, October 1998.
-
(1998)
Programming from Specification
-
-
Morgan, C.1
-
27
-
-
2942523861
-
Fundamental concepts and formal semantics of programming languages
-
University of Aarhus, Denmark, January
-
P. D. Mosses. Fundamental concepts and formal semantics of programming languages. BRICS and Department of Computer Science, University of Aarhus, Denmark, January 2002.
-
(2002)
BRICS and Department of Computer Science
-
-
Mosses, P.D.1
-
28
-
-
26444440692
-
Converting informal meta-data to VDM-SL: A reverse calculation approach
-
20-21 September, Toulouse, France, September
-
F. L. Neves, J. C. Silva, and J. N. Oliveira. Converting informal meta-data to VDM-SL: A reverse calculation approach. In VDM in Practice A Workshop co-located with FM'99: The World Congress on Formal Methods, 20-21 September, Toulouse, France, September 1999.
-
(1999)
VDM in Practice A Workshop Co-located with FM'99: The World Congress on Formal Methods
-
-
Neves, J.C.1
Silva, F.L.2
Oliveira, J.N.3
-
29
-
-
84885482003
-
An introduction to pointfree programming, Departamento de Informtica, Universidade do Minho
-
J. Oliveira. An introduction to pointfree programming, 1999. Departamento de Informtica, Universidade do Minho. 37p., chapter of book in preparation.
-
(1999)
Chapter of Book in Preparation
, pp. 3-7
-
-
Oliveira, J.1
-
30
-
-
0040832771
-
A reification calculus for model-oriented software specification
-
April
-
J. N. Oliveira. A reification calculus for model-oriented software specification. Formal aspects on computing, 2(1):1-23, April 1990.
-
(1990)
Formal Aspects on Computing
, vol.2
, Issue.1
, pp. 1-23
-
-
Oliveira, J.N.1
-
31
-
-
0039646422
-
Software reification using the sets calculus
-
London, UK., 8-10 January, Springer-Verlag. (Invited paper)
-
J. N. Oliveira. Software reification using the sets calculus. In Proc. of the BCS FACS 5th Refinement Workshop, Theory and Practice of Formal Software Development, pages 140-171, London, UK., 8-10 January 1992. Springer-Verlag. (Invited paper).
-
(1992)
Proc. of the BCS FACS 5th Refinement Workshop, Theory and Practice of Formal Software Development
, pp. 140-171
-
-
Oliveira, J.N.1
-
32
-
-
33746081590
-
Bagatelle in C arranged for VDM SoLo
-
Special Issue on Formal Aspects of Software Engineering (Colloquium in Honor of Peter Lucas, Institute for Software Technology, Graz University of Technology, May 18-19, 2001)
-
J. N. Oliveira. Bagatelle in C arranged for VDM SoLo. Journal of Universal Computer Science, 7(8):754-781, 2001. Special Issue on Formal Aspects of Software Engineering (Colloquium in Honor of Peter Lucas, Institute for Software Technology, Graz University of Technology, May 18-19, 2001).
-
(2001)
Journal of Universal Computer Science
, vol.7
, Issue.8
, pp. 754-781
-
-
Oliveira, J.N.1
-
38
-
-
84884727583
-
Transforming a program into specifications
-
Durham University, Jan.
-
M. P. Ward. Transforming a program into specifications. Technical Report 88-1, Durham University, Jan. 1993.
-
(1993)
Technical Report 88-1
-
-
Ward, M.P.1
-
39
-
-
3743064955
-
Program analysis by formal transformation
-
M. P. Ward. Program analysis by formal transformation. The Computer Journal, 39(7), 1996.
-
(1996)
The Computer Journal
, vol.39
, Issue.7
-
-
Ward, M.P.1
-
40
-
-
84963829492
-
The transformational approach to source code analysis and manipulation
-
Florence, Italy, November, IEEE CS Press
-
M. P. Ward. The transformational approach to source code analysis and manipulation. In First International Workshop on Source Code Analysis and Manipulation, Florence, Italy, November 2001. IEEE CS Press.
-
(2001)
First International Workshop on Source Code Analysis and Manipulation
-
-
Ward, M.P.1
-
41
-
-
0002892120
-
A practical program transformation system for reverse engineering
-
Baltimore, USA, May, WCRE
-
M. P. Ward and K. H. Bennett. A practical program transformation system for reverse engineering. In Working Conference on Reverse Engineering, Baltimore, USA, May 1993. WCRE.
-
(1993)
Working Conference on Reverse Engineering
-
-
Ward, M.P.1
Bennett, K.H.2
|